Watch Rishi Sunak call for an end to 'sick note culture' in his speech on welfare reform today (April 19).< /p>

The Prime Minister used his speech to warn against “the over-medicalisation of everyday challenges and worries”.

As Britain emerges from the coronavirus pandemic and recovers finds itself facing a cost of living crisis, with NHS waiting lists reaching record levels, the number of working days lost due to illness or injury has reached a new record.

In a speech on Friday morning, Mr Sunak echoed his chancellor Jeremy Hunt in insisting the focus must be on what workers could be. are able to do so, amid government concerns some are unnecessarily written off as sick and "parked on welfare".
